Transaction 0887859b8626fad25cb44c55745e62ab43332fc15c443c5ae80e951150953695

1 Input
2 Outputs
  • 0887859b8626fad25cb44c55745e62ab43332fc15c443c5ae80e951150953695:0
  • value  74681
    address  3Bo7HVHMQND9f9wkfkF8ggcnRBpi4wtZL8
  • 0887859b8626fad25cb44c55745e62ab43332fc15c443c5ae80e951150953695:1
  • value  117804
    address  164CSMScZJanRULuMhbtZHWfEppwrg9jji